This year, the Birthing Kit Foundation (Australia) will reach an amazing milestone: assembly and distribution of its 1,000,000th birthing kit. These simple kits have provided one million mothers and babies in developing countries with a much better chance of having a healthy birth.
To commemorate this achievement, and to thank everyone who has helped make the project an inspiring success, Zonta International clubs in support of the Foundation are holding celebratory events throughout Australia.
